    This is tough, and I don't know your friends, but I was thinking maybe it would be cute to stick with the theme?   What about cute aprons, or even teacups.  I know my mom collects pretty teacups (not sure where she gets them from), and they are very pretty.  Favorite colors would probably help with both of those ideas.  Depending how much you want to spend, you could incorporate those ideas into some kind of gift basket.  You could include mad housewife wine in the basket!
